our worker processs, we do not run any WebKit code in main thread. Thus when multiple workers try to start at the same time, we might hit crash due to contention for initializing static values. The fix is to do the initialization first in main thread of worker process.

WebWorkerClient/WebWorker are parallel interfaces of WebCore::{WorkerObjectProxy, WorkerContextProxy} that use Chrome data types. When WebKit requests a WorkerObjectProxy, we create an instance of WebWorkerClientImpl. This class creates an object that implements a Chromium version of WorkerObjectProxy (i.e. with Chrome data types) through WebViewDelegate. That object is a WebWorkerProxy and talks over IPC to a WebWorker object in the worker process. The WebWorker object creates the actual WebCore::Worker object using another class in glue: WebWorkerImpl.
When the WebCore::Worker object running in the worker process wants to talk back to the code running in the renderer, it talks to WebWorkerImpl which implements WebCore::WorkerObjectProxy. WebWorkerImpl converts the data types to Chrome compatible ones, and then calls the WebWorkerClient version which does IPC to get to the renderer process. This ends up at WebWorkerProxy, which calls WebWorkerClientImpl (the original class).
In future changes, sandboxing, multiple worker processes etc will be added. Note that I also had to make two small changes to WebKit, since WorkerMessagingProxy couldn't be created as is for the nested worker case. I'll either check it in myself or work with Jian to do so.
